Full Description
1999: (see 'Not to be published on web' tab for finder/s and/or findspot/s) Metal detector(?) find of gold quarter stater (Van Arsdell 1460-1, also known as British G or the late Clacton type) of circa 60 BC. Weight 1.37g. Details in file (S1).
